goloka chāḍiya prabhu kena bā abanī kāla-rūpa kena haila gorā-baraṇa-khani
अर्थ

Why did the Supreme Lord leave Goloka? Why did He change His dark form into a form with a fair complexion?

hāsa bilāsa chāḍi kena pahuṁ kānde nā jāni ṭhekila gorā kāra prema-phānde
अर्थ

Why, leaving behind His pastimes of joking and laughter, does the Lord now weep? I do not know. Why and for whom did Lord Gaura set His trap of ecstatic spiritual love?

kṣaṇe kṛṣṇa kṛṣṇa bali kānde ghana-ghana khaṇe sakhī sakhī bali karaye rodana
अर्थ

One moment He calls out "Kṛṣṇa! Kṛṣṇa!" and weeps. The next moment He calls out, "Sakhī! Sakhī!"

mathurā mathurā bali karaye bilāpa kṣaṇe bā akrūra bali kare anutāpa
अर्थ

One moment He calls out, "Mathurā! Mathurā!" Another moment He calls out, "Akrūra!" He is distraught.

kṣaṇe kṣaṇe bale chiye cānda candana dhūlāya loṭāye kānde yata nija-jana
अर्थ

Moment after moment He calls out, "Wretched moon! Wretched sandal paste!" He rolls in the dust. Surrounded by His companions, He weeps.

chāra parāṇa kulabatīra nā yāya kahite ākula pahuṁ dhūlāya loṭāya
अर्थ

"Although they have been burned into ashes, the saintly gopīs do not give up their lives!", He says. Filled with distress, He rolls on the ground.

gadādhara kānde prāṇa-nātha laiyā kole rāya rāmānanda kānde praṇaya bikale
अर्थ

Gadādhara weeps. He hugs the master of his life. Rāmānanda Rāya weeps. He is tossed to and fro by ecstatic spiritual love.

svarūpa śrī-rūpa kānde soṅari bilāsa nā bujhiyā kānde nayanānanda dāsa
अर्थ

Svarūpa Dāmodara and Rūpa Gosvāmī also weep. Remembering these pastimes, but not understanding anything of them, Nayanānanda dāsa also weeps.
